    Still too much loud on cold start of my 2016 Camaro SS, V8 6.2 with Bolra S axle back

    My neighbor is complaining for loud start up on cold winter season in South Korea.

    So, I changed the value in below.
    Loud start up.jpg

    A little bit better than nothing. But, still loud.
    So I reduced Idle RPM value in Idle -> Start up -> P/N to Max 900RPM in every ECT and engine run time.

    But, again still loud at first 4 sec.

    It looks this loud start up came from Spark Retard as below. See spark retard hit -12 degree in 2 sec.
    Loud start up-scanned.jpg


    Guys, How can I remove this spark retard at cold start up.

    That is the flare control after start up. on gen4 we would have a table to adjust for gen 5 i believe you have to work on the idle tq tables. you can also adjust your min spark table for the rpms that have the negative spark but you may end up with a really high start up flare. getting the flare after start up and the timing to stay positive will cure this or at least help a great deal
